What Mindfulness Based Therapy Is

Mindfulness-based therapy is an approach that helps individuals become more aware of their thoughts, emotions, and physical experiences in the present moment. Rather than trying to eliminate difficult thoughts or feelings, mindfulness focuses on observing them without judgment. What Mindfulness-Based Therapy Helps With

Mindfulness-based therapy is commonly used to support:

  • Stress and burnout
  • Anxiety and overthinking
  • Emotional regulation
  • Difficulty focusing
  • Mood-related challenges

It is often used alongside other therapeutic approaches to enhance overall treatment.

How Mindfulness-Based Therapy Works

This approach focuses on increasing awareness of present-moment experiences. Clients learn to observe thoughts and emotions without immediately reacting to them, which helps reduce automatic responses and emotional overwhelm.

Over time, mindfulness can help create space between thoughts and reactions, allowing for more intentional decision-making and improved emotional balance.

What Sessions Look Like

Sessions may include guided mindfulness exercises, breathing techniques, or discussions about how to apply mindfulness in daily life. Therapists help clients build awareness gradually and develop practical ways to use mindfulness outside of sessions.
The process is flexible and tailored to each individual’s comfort level.
